About Cromwellian Building
What you're looking at is a structure with proper historical bones - the kind of place that makes you think about what daily life was like during one of England's most turbulent periods. The building itself tells that story more effectively than many museums manage to do with countless plaques and explanatory panels.
History enthusiasts will find genuine value here. Casual visitors who've wandered over from Henley expecting theatrical displays might feel underwhelmed. It's not a grand affair with interactive zones and gift shops - it's simply a building that survived, which is precisely what makes it compelling if you're interested in the period.
The camping options nearby are solid for a Thames Valley base. Swiss Farm and Henley Four Oaks are both within easy striking distance, roughly two miles away. You could easily combine this with riverside walks or a visit to Henley itself without overloading an itinerary.
Best approached as part of a broader exploration of the area rather than a standalone destination. Allow an hour if you're thorough, less if you simply want the visual and atmospheric hit. Check locally before visiting - details on opening hours and admission aren't readily available online, so a quick call ahead is wise.
